Chuck Sykes is Alabama's Director of Wildlife & Freshwater Fisheries. His resume is loaded with way more than college degrees. He’s a trapper, hunter, turkey guide and biologist. His knowledge is deep rooted and well earned. From turkey guide to a suit and tie, Chuck’s journey is an interesting one.
